Professional duct cleaning services from reputable companies use special blowers, vacuums and brushes to thoroughly clean intake, supply and return air ducts. The cleaning– when done properly– includes all grilles, registers, air handlers, motors, fans, housings, coils and other parts.

Is air duct cleaning really necessary? There are a lot of air duct cleaning services out there– and most reputable heating and air conditioning companies offer air duct cleaning too.

Research doesn’t prove definitively that air duct cleaning improves indoor air quality or reduces dust. We believe it can make a difference and occasionally should be performed as part of your regular home maintenance. It’s especially useful in the follow situations:

To avoid being taken in by a scammer claiming to offer legitimate air duct cleaning services, take the following actions:

Get references. Find out who else has been helped by the services.
Insist on full service. Make sure your entire system is cleaned, not just ducts and vents.
Get a quote in advance. Know what you’ll be paying before work is started. No reputable company will refuse you a quote, and you should avoid any company that’s hesitant to talk about price up front.
Forget about gimmicks. Air duct cleaning should cost more than $79, and you don’t want to deal with a company that just does a little vacuuming and then collects their fee.
Look for certifications. You don’t want uneducated or inexperienced people working in your home. You want industry-certified professionals with strong reputations, background checks and more.
Avoid sealants. Experts recommend against using sealants that can add harmful chemicals to the air inside your home. These products are more about padding the bill than protecting you and your home.
Don’t allow steam cleaning. You don’t want to use any cleaning method that adds moisture to your ducts and your home, leading to a breeding ground for bacteria and other pathogens.

Pests. If you’ve had rodent infestation or other unwelcome animals or insects in your home, having your ducts cleaned can be an important part of getting rid of the things they leave behind and re-establishing a clean home.

Remodeling. Air duct cleaning is a smart idea if you’ve had dusty remodeling done to your home. This is crucial if you’ve had lead paint removal, asbestos removal or if your HVAC system wasn’t prepared and sealed off before remodeling started.

If you have animals that shed a lot, you could have pet hair and dander in your air ducts. If you see pet hair on your sofa or the carpet, you can be sure it’s in the ducts too.

Mold and contaminants. Diseases, mold and other tiny particulate matter can invade your home’s air ducts. It makes sense to have your ducts cleaned to put an end to the contamination if you’ve had a problem with mold or other contaminants.
